[0001] This invention relates to the field of adhesive type testing equipment, and more specifically, to a method for determining the type of PVC adhesive based on viscosity number testing. Background Technology

[0002] In recent years, the demand for PVC pipes has grown rapidly in fields such as construction, industrial wastewater treatment, and agricultural irrigation. PVC adhesive, as a single-component transparent solution, has become a core material for cross-bonding PVC pipes with metal / non-metal materials due to its high bonding strength, corrosion resistance, and rapid curing characteristics. With the rapid development of PVC pipe applications, the performance requirements for PVC adhesives are becoming increasingly stringent. In PVC adhesives, the molecular weight difference of PVC resin can affect the flow properties and bonding effect to a certain extent. Based on the viscosity of PVC resin, it can be divided into several grades from SG1 to SG9. Currently, the viscosity grades of PVC adhesives purchased on the market are not clearly specified. Before actual use, it is necessary to determine the grade to ensure that it is used in the appropriate application. Regarding the determination of PVC adhesive grades, the industry currently faces the following technical bottlenecks:

[0003] (1) Lack of standardized testing methods: Existing methods only evaluate the performance of adhesives through experience or simple direct viscosity tests, which cannot quantify the accurate viscosity number (K ​​value) of PVC resin, resulting in a lack of scientific basis for the selection and use of adhesives;

[0004] (2) Residual interference: In the existing viscosity number detection methods, the PVC resin in PVC glue is difficult to refine, resulting in poor purity. At present, there is no special equipment for PVC resin purification on the market. The sample mass required for testing needs to be 0.125g±0.025g, which results in a large sample amount and difficulty in dissolving. In addition, the residual additives and solvents interfere with and affect the final measurement accuracy, leading to errors in the determination of PVC glue type. Summary of the Invention

[0027] A method for determining the type of PVC adhesive based on viscosity number detection includes the following steps:

[0028] S1. Take 5g of glue sample and place it in a container. Put the glue sample into the glue cleaning device.

[0029] S2. Use ethylene glycol with a purity of ≥99.5% (called anhydrous ethylene glycol) to clean the glue sample. The cleaning process involves stirring and is repeated three times to ensure that the additives and solvents in the glue are dissolved and removed, leaving only white solids. Collect the white solids that have been precipitated. The white solids are high-purity PVC resin with no additives or solvents remaining.

[0030] S3. Take out the PVC resin and place it in the drying oven to dry it. The drying temperature of the drying oven is set to 105±2℃. Drying is to allow the ethylene glycol residue on the PVC resin to evaporate and be removed quickly.

[0031] S4. Cool the dried PVC resin sample to 25±1℃, and then weigh 0.0600±0.0005g of the sample using a precision balance (0.0001g).

[0032] S5. Add 20mL of cyclohexanone to the container and place it in a water bath for constant temperature heating to promote the dissolution of PVC resin sample in cyclohexanone. Set the water bath temperature to 80-85℃ and the water bath time to 1 hour.

[0033] S6. Cool to a constant temperature in a water bath. The constant temperature of the water bath is set to 25±1℃. Then, use an Ubbelohde viscometer to measure the viscosity data. Determine the type of PVC glue based on the viscosity data (using an Ubbelohde viscometer to measure the viscosity data is an existing technology specified in the current standard, and will not be described in detail here).

[0040] The PVC resin sample cleaned by the glue cleaning device of this invention has the advantage of high purity, with no additives or solvent residues. Therefore, a small sample size can be used for subsequent determination. The amount of PVC resin sample can be reduced to 0.0600±0.0005g, which helps the PVC resin sample to dissolve quickly and completely in cyclohexanone, ensuring the accuracy of subsequent viscosity measurement data.

[0041] The method of this invention can accurately determine the PVC resin viscosity data of the glue sample, thereby determining the specific type of PVC glue. The unit of PVC resin viscosity is mL / g. Common viscosity ranges for different types include SG5 (107-118), SG7 (87-95), and SG8 (73-86).

[0042] In this invention, acetone can be used instead of anhydrous ethanol for cleaning, but acetone is highly volatile and requires more than four cleaning cycles. Tetrahydrofuran (THF) can be used instead of cyclohexanone to dissolve PVC resin samples, but this reagent has a low dissolution rate for PVC resin (requiring an extended dissolution time of up to 90 minutes) and high toxicity (requiring a closed dissolution system for operation).
